General annotation (Comments)
| Function | May function in reproductive organs during embryogenesis and seed maturation. |
| Catalytic activity | Random hydrolysis of N-acetyl-beta-D-glucosaminide (1->4)-beta-linkages in chitin and chitodextrins. |
| Tissue specificity | Expressed in sheaths and meristems and at lower levels in roots and leaves. Ref.7 |
| Sequence similarities | Belongs to the glycosyl hydrolase 19 family. Chitinase class IV subfamily. Contains 1 chitin-binding type-1 domain. |
